AHR agonist 4

SKU: orb2277945

Description

AHR agonist 4 (compound 24e) is a potent aryl hydrocarbon receptor agonist that shifts the immune balance from Th17/22 towards Treg cells. It serves as a lead compound in psoriasis research, effectively reducing IMQ-induced psoriasis-like skin inflammation in vivo.
